Understanding The Role Of A Landlord Tenant Lawyer

Navigating the complex world of landlord-tenant relationships can be overwhelming and stressful for both parties involved Disputes can arise at any point during the tenancy, from lease agreements to maintenance issues to eviction proceedings When conflicts cannot be resolved amicably, it may be necessary to seek the guidance of a landlord-tenant lawyer.

A landlord-tenant lawyer specializes in legal matters related to rental properties and the relationships between landlords and tenants These professionals have a deep understanding of local and state laws governing rental agreements and can help clients navigate the complexities of the legal system Whether you are a landlord or a tenant facing a dispute, having a knowledgeable lawyer on your side can make all the difference in reaching a fair and favorable resolution.

One of the primary roles of a landlord-tenant lawyer is to advise clients on their rights and responsibilities under the law Landlord-tenant laws vary from state to state, and it can be difficult for the average person to keep up with the ever-changing regulations A lawyer who specializes in this area of law can provide guidance on issues such as lease agreements, security deposits, maintenance and repairs, and eviction procedures By staying informed about the latest legal developments, a landlord-tenant lawyer can help clients protect their rights and avoid costly legal pitfalls.

In addition to providing legal advice, a landlord-tenant lawyer can also represent clients in court proceedings If a dispute between a landlord and tenant cannot be resolved through negotiation or mediation, it may be necessary to take the matter to court A lawyer who is experienced in landlord-tenant law can advocate on behalf of their client and present a strong case in court Whether you are seeking to enforce your rights as a landlord or defend yourself against eviction as a tenant, having a skilled lawyer by your side can greatly increase your chances of achieving a favorable outcome.

In many cases, litigation can be costly and time-consuming, and both landlords and tenants may prefer to find a more efficient and cost-effective solution A lawyer who specializes in landlord-tenant law can explore alternative dispute resolution methods such as negotiation, mediation, or arbitration By working with both parties to find a mutually agreeable solution, a lawyer can help avoid the need for costly and protracted court proceedings.

For landlords, hiring a landlord-tenant lawyer can help protect their investments and ensure that their properties are managed in compliance with the law A lawyer can help landlords draft lease agreements that are clear and enforceable, conduct evictions in accordance with state law, and address tenant complaints or disputes in a timely and professional manner By proactively seeking legal advice, landlords can minimize their risk of legal liability and ensure a smooth and successful tenancy.

Tenants can also benefit from the counsel of a landlord-tenant lawyer when facing difficult landlords or housing issues A lawyer can help tenants understand their rights under the law, negotiate with landlords on their behalf, and defend against wrongful eviction or landlord harassment By enlisting the help of a lawyer, tenants can level the playing field and ensure that their rights are protected throughout the tenancy.
